タグ

Debianとパッケージに関するItisangoのブックマーク (4)

  • Debianパッケージ作成支援ツール「cme」登場、GUIでの操作も可能 | スラド Linux

    https://github.com/dod38fr/config-model/blob/master/README.pod [github.com] を見てもらうとわかるけど、一応「interactive configuration editor」を目指した設定ファイル編集のための汎用ツールなの。 で、それにDebianパッケージ用のプラグインが追加されたよ、という話。 #debパッケージの作成はそんなに難しいとは感じない。通常のプログラム書くほうがよっぽど大変ですよ…。 #debパッケージの作成はそんなに難しいとは感じない。通常のプログラム書くほうがよっぽど大変ですよ…。 Debian関係者? 開発者の立場からすると開発の体に集中したいのに、普及戦略の一貫とはいえDebian(もしくはUbuntu)という1ディストリビューションのためのややこしいルールを学ぶのは疲れます。 自作の人気

  • Debian パッケージ作成法

    開発環境の構築 パッケージの作成 リビジョンを上げる 上流のバージョンを上げる quilt CDBS debhelper ルール buildvars.mk buildcore.mk debhelper.mk makefile ルール makefile-vars.mk makefile.mk autotools ルール autotools-vars.mk autotools-files.mk autotools.mk svn-buildpackage 既存のパッケージをレポジトリにインポート ビルドする upstream のバージョンアップ git-buildpackage 既存のパッケージをレポジトリにインポート 上流のソースコードからパッケージを作成する ビルドする 上流のバージョンアップ パッチをつくる reprepro 出力先を変更する まとめてレポジトリに登録する 1. 開発環境の

    Itisango
    Itisango 2013/08/27
    #Debian #Linux #package #howto #build #tips
  • Debian パッケージの作り方

    Debian や RedHat ではソフトウェアを「パッケージ」という単位で管理しま す. WindowsMac 等とは違い, 自分のインストールしたソフトウェアを統一的 に管理することができます. 目次 Debian パッケージの管理法 Debian パッケージの構造 Debian パッケージの作り方 Debian パッケージの管理法 Debian パッケージは, パッケージ同士の依存関係を管理してくれます. dpkg, dselect, apt という強力なパッケージ管理ツールが揃っていて, それによってパッケージ管理することができます. で, 依存するパッケージも含めて全てインストールしてくれます. Debian パッケージの構造 Debian パッケージには 2 種類のファイルが格納されています. パッケージの制御情報 /(ルート)以下に格納するファイル群(実行ファイル, 設

  • debパッケージのビルド手順

    debuildなどのパッケージビルドツールでは、大まかに言うと、 一般的に次のような手順でパッケージをビルドします。 ビルド環境を整備する。不要なファイルを削除する (debian/rules clean)。ソースパッケージをまとめる (dpkg-source -b ディレクトリ名)。バイナリパッケージにインストールするファイルをビルドする (debian/rules build)。ビルドしたファイルをバイナリパッケージにまとめる (debian/rules binary)。.changesファイルを作成する (dpkg-genchanges)。パッケージに署名する。 実際にビルドを始める前に、まずはビルドのための環境を整える必要があります。 「ビルドのための環境を整える」と一口に言っても色々とありますが、 例えばソースパッケージの展開などが挙げられます。 ソースパッケージをビルドする場合

    Itisango
    Itisango 2013/01/05
    #deb パッケージのビルド手順。 #debian #Linux #Ubuntu
  • 1